What Lovers means for you

The Lovers is the sixth major arcana card, numbered 6 and known as VI in Roman numerals. This places it early in the sequence, where themes of union and choice begin to unfold.

This arcana’s individuals often wrestle with decisions that shape their identity, feeling the weight of each choice profoundly. They thrive in environments where their sense of ethical alignment and personal truth can be expressed openly. Unlike others who may seek independence as a goal, these people see their identity defined through the interplay of union and balance with others and themselves.

Your strengths

They excel at bringing people together and clarifying complex value conflicts. Their ability to weigh options carefully makes them excellent mediators and trusted advisors in matters of heart and principle. In teamwork or partnerships, they foster cooperation and mutual respect, often acting as the glue that keeps groups aligned toward a shared vision.

Where growth happens

Developing decisiveness and trusting their internal compass is crucial. They benefit from practices that help distinguish true desires from societal expectations. Learning to assert boundaries without guilt allows them to maintain relationships that support rather than drain their essence.

Shadow to watch

This arcana's drive for alignment can lead to paralysis when faced with ambiguous choices. They may become overly dependent on external validation or the approval of key relationships to define their worth. The cost is indecision and a tendency to sacrifice personal needs to maintain peace, which can breed hidden resentment or loss of self.

With others

In relationships

In love, they seek partners who respect their need for honest communication and shared values. They crave emotional and intellectual alignment, valuing transparency over superficial charm. Conflict arises when their partner demands conformity or when they feel forced to compromise their core beliefs for harmony, which can create tension and withdrawal.

In the world

At work

They thrive in roles requiring negotiation, diplomacy, or ethical decision-making. Work environments that respect individuality within collaborative frameworks energize them. Conversely, rigid hierarchies or jobs demanding blind obedience drain their spirit and creativity, leading to frustration and disengagement.
